OpenAI Chief Scientist Warns on Recursive Self-Improvement
OpenAI chief scientist Jakub Pachocki warns that AI progress could sustain into recursive self-improvement while alignment and monitoring capabilities lag behind. He calls for stronger safety bars, human oversight, and voluntary slowdowns when confidence is insufficient.
OpenAI’s message is unusually candid: the bottleneck may soon be proving advanced systems remain controllable, not building more capable ones.
- –Reasoning models increasingly participate in AI research, creating a feedback loop that could accelerate capability gains.
- –Chain-of-thought monitoring becomes less reliable as models use tools, interact with other systems, and reason in less-visible ways.
- –Goal alignment is insufficient if models behave dangerously under ambiguous, adversarial, or unfamiliar conditions.
- –Shared safety standards, third-party audits, and international coordination may be necessary to constrain frontier development.
- –Developers should treat interpretability, evaluation, and monitoring as core infrastructure for increasingly autonomous AI systems.
